Brief Summary
The main purpose of the protocol is to test the efficiency of art-therapy versus metacognitive rehabilitation on the visual perception disorders observed in patients with schizophrenia.
Investigators
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•schizophrenia according to DSM IV
Exclusion Criteria
- •addiction problem
- •invalidating visual sensory problems
- •neurological history
Outcomes
Primary Outcomes
Change in Response times between baseline and after 16 therapy sessions
Time Frame: Baseline and after 16 therapy sessions (up to 6 months)
Secondary Outcomes
- Change in Clinical scales (SAPS and SANS) between baseline and after 16 therapy sessions(Baseline and after 16 therapy sessions (up to 6 months))
- Change in errors in visual organization tasks between baseline and after 16 therapy sessions(aseline and after 16 therapy sessions (up to 6 months))
- Change in esthetic perception between baseline and after 16 therapy sessions(Baseline and after 16 therapy sessions (up to 6 months))
